Lemon Grove Day Camp

The City of Lemon Grove Community Services Division provides exciting and enriching opportunities for children to stay active, make new friends, and explore their creativity — all in a safe and welcoming environment.

Our seasonal Day Camps are open to children in Kindergarten through 8th grade, offering a wide variety of indoor and outdoor activities including sports, arts and crafts, games, STEM projects, clubs, themed events, and more! Each camp is led by our dedicated team of trained, caring, and enthusiastic Community Services staff who prioritize your child’s safety, growth, and fun.

Day Camp sessions align with the Lemon Grove School District calendar and are offered during school breaks, including Spring Break, Summer, Fall, Turkey and Winter.

Times of operation and Location

-6:30 a.m.-6:00 p.m.

- Lemon Grove Recreation Center

 3131 School Lane Lemon Grove CA, 91945

What should campers bring? 

- Bring at least two nutritional snacks and a lunch everyday

9:00 a.m. 1st  Snack

12:00 p.m. Lunch

3:00 p.m. 2nd Snack

- Lots of water

The Lemon Grove Recreation Center has a refillable water station. 

- Wear sneakers/tennis shoes for safe play time (No open toe shoes, sandals, crocs) 

- We highly recommend labeling jackets, water bottles and lunch pails.  

- Refrain from bringing any valuables to camp, the City will not be responsible for lost or stolen items

What should you bring for pick up?

-Rec. Staff will ID every adult at the gate for pick up

What is the capacity? 

-125 Campers

Sample Daily Schedule:

6:30 am -9:00 am   Check in, courtyard games, four square, tether ball, board games, pool, ping pong, air hockey, movies and reading.

9:00 am -9:30 a.m. 1st snack

9:30 - 12:00 pm  Campers will participate in a variety of sports, games, arts & crafts. Gym activities include: dodge ball, indoor soccer, basketball, volleyball, flag football, kickball, capture the flag, blue mat wars, Kings and Queens,, etc. Arts and crafts in room.

12:00 pm- 12:30 pm  Lunch

12:00 pm- 3:00 pm  Campers will participate in a variety of sports, games, arts & crafts. These activities include: dodge ball, indoor soccer, basketball, volleyball, flag football, kickball, capture the flag, blue mat wars, Kings and Queens wiffle ball, etc.

3:00 pm- 3:30 pm  2nd snack

3:30 pm- 6:00 pm   Check out, courtyard games, four square, tether ball, board games, pool, ping pong, air hockey, movies and reading.
